The Georgia Bulldogs may be looking for the next great transfer quarterback this off-season. With Jake Fromm potentially entering into the NFL Draft after the Sugar Bowl, Georgia must be prepared to pursue all options this off-season. As it currently stands, four-star QB commit Carson Beck is set to be the favorite for Georgia’s starting job if Fromm heads to the NFL.

Georgia has lost their fair share of QBs to the transfer portal over the years, but is it time for UGA to go into the portal to secure a talented passer? It’d give Beck one year to develop and learn the system before starting. Beck wouldn’t have to start at Alabama early next season.

If Fromm doesn’t return, Kirby Smart may want to pursue Wake Forest’s Jamie Newman. Newman helped lead Wake Forest to a 9-5 season. He put up impressive numbers last season:

Other talented QBs in the portal include: K.J. Costello (Stanford), Feleipe Franks (Florida, no thanks), Justin Rogers (TCU), and Jack Allison (West Virginia). Who will be the next transfer to be a Heisman contender? The best bet would be Wake Forest’s Jamie Newman.

As for now, it is only speculation on where is next for Newman. UGA may not need a QB next season with either Fromm or Beck. Regardless, Georgia could use a back-up.
